THE PAIN MANAGEMENT GROUP is a multi-disciplinary team of board-certified physicians and advanced practitioners dedicated to the treatment of acute and chronic pain in Middle Tennessee. As Tennessee's most established pain management practice, we have been seeing patients in Middle Tennessee since 1996.
